Abstract

Polymers lead to become emerging materials as corrosion inhibitors for mild steel in acidic media due to its larger surface area. This paper focuses on the characteristic of water solvent Polyvinyl Alcohol (PVA) at interface of Mild Steel under 0.5 M HCl, examined using electrochemical impedance spectroscopy, Tafel polarization and weight reduction techniques. These entire outcomes of the study of characteristic of inhibitor behaved as in well connection and the restraint proficiency, which shows up to 93.7% in 0.5 M hydrochloric acid for 3hrs term. An advanced form of high spatial resolution imaging of surface of mild steel at different stages was found by using scanning electron microscopy.
